US Army Signal Corps Switchboard. When I received it was new in a double cardboard box from the Army. Condition is NOS. Model BD-57-B built by Cook Electric in Chicago. Appears to be WWII vintage but I'm not sure. If someone knows the history please email me and I will add to this listing. Check my feedback. I'll been on eBay since 1999 and never a negative feedback.Received this message from a fellow eBayer: From my reference material: This was one of the components for the code practice equipment EE-81, a classroom Morse code practice set for training up to 20 operators under an instructor. The ID tag is the same as the model listed in my reference book-so it is a WW2 era signal trainer.
